Deck Staining in Waco, TX

Deck staining services involve applying a protective and decorative finish to outdoor wooden decks. This process typically includes cleaning the surface, preparing it properly, and then applying stain or sealant to enhance the wood’s appearance while providing protection against weather elements, UV rays, and wear. Projects can range from refreshing an existing deck to restoring older wood surfaces, as well as staining new constructions to achieve a desired color or finish. Homeowners often request deck staining to improve curb appeal, extend the lifespan of their deck, and maintain its appearance over time.

Before requesting deck staining services, property owners should consider the current condition of their deck, including the state of the wood and existing finishes. It’s important to determine whether the surface requires cleaning, sanding, or repairs prior to staining. Additionally, understanding the different types of stains available-such as transparent, semi-transparent, or solid-and how they impact the look and durability of the deck can help in making an informed decision. Proper preparation and choosing the right stain can ensure the best results and long-lasting protection for outdoor wooden surfaces.

FAQ

Deck Staining Questions

What types of decks can be stained? Deck staining services typically cover wood decks made of pressure-treated lumber, cedar, redwood, composite, or other common materials used in residential outdoor spaces.

How often should a deck be stained? It is generally recommended to stain a deck every 2 to 3 years to maintain protection and appearance, depending on weather conditions and usage.

What are the benefits of staining a deck? Staining helps protect the wood from moisture, UV damage, and wear, while enhancing the natural beauty and color of the deck surface.

Can existing stain be removed before applying a new coat? Yes, existing stain can be stripped or sanded off to ensure proper adhesion of the new stain and a smooth finish.
